WebSetting is defined simply as the time and location in which the story takes place. The setting is also the background against which the action happens. For example, Hogwarts becomes the location, or setting, where Harry, Hermione, and Ron have many of their adventures. Keep in mind that longer works often have multiple settings. WebSetting can also play a crucial role in establishing the mood of a story. The time of year, weather, and overall atmosphere of a location can all contribute to the overall tone of the story. For example, a story set in a sunny beach town might have a light and carefree mood, while a story set in a haunted house might have a darker, more ominous tone.
